Why Panel Upgrades Matter ⚡
Think of your electrical panel as the traffic cop for all the electricity in your home or business. It directs energy where it’s needed, keeps circuits from getting too crowded, and steps in when something goes wrong. But just like any hardworking system, panels can wear out or become outdated.
Old panels—especially those installed 20, 30, or even 40 years ago—weren’t built for today’s demands. Air conditioners, computer networks, EV chargers, powerful kitchen appliances: they all draw more power than homes and businesses needed decades ago. If your panel isn’t up to the task, you’re at risk for:
- Overloaded circuits that trip or even start fires.
- Outdated parts that don’t meet modern safety codes, like those set out by the National Electrical Code (NEC).
- Hidden corrosion or wear that can cause dangerous short circuits.
- Insurance issues if your system isn’t up to code or passes a safety inspection.
Signs Your Panel Needs Replacement
Not sure if your panel is on its last legs? Here are some red flags that it’s time to call in an emergency electrician for repairs near you:
1. Age of the Panel
If your panel is more than 25–30 years old, it probably can’t keep up. Panels from the 1970s–90s often lack the capacity for today’s power needs and may use components that are no longer considered safe.
2. Frequent Breaker Trips
Breakers are designed to trip when a circuit is overloaded. If this happens once in a blue moon, it’s probably just a fluke. But if you’re resetting breakers every week—or worse, every day—it’s a sign your panel is struggling.
3. Warm or Buzzing Panel
Touch your panel (carefully). If it feels warm or you hear a low buzzing, that’s a red flag. Heat means electricity may not be flowing safely. Buzzing can indicate loose or failing connections.
4. Corrosion or Rust
Water and electricity don’t mix. Corrosion, rust, or visible signs of moisture inside or around your panel can spell trouble. Left unchecked, this can lead to electrical shorts and fire hazards.
5. New Power-Hungry Devices
Adding a pool, hot tub, EV charger, or commercial equipment? Your old panel might not have enough capacity or the right circuits to handle these safely.
What Happens During an Upgrade
Worried about what an upgrade involves? Here’s what you can expect from start to finish:
Step 1: Inspection and Planning
A licensed electrician will inspect your existing system, check your current and future power needs, and design a new setup that fits your property and meets all local and national codes.
Step 2: Power Shutdown
For everyone’s safety, your power will be shut off during the upgrade. This usually takes several hours, so plan ahead for any business operations or home needs.
Step 3: Panel Removal and Installation
The old panel is carefully disconnected and removed. New wiring may be installed to support additional circuits or higher capacity. The new panel and breakers are mounted, connected, and labeled.
Step 4: Testing and Inspection
All connections are tested. The new panel is checked for proper operation and safety. Depending on your location, a city or county inspector may need to sign off before power is restored.
Step 5: Power On and Walkthrough
Once approved, power is restored. Your electrician will walk you through any new features, label circuits, and answer your questions.
Cost and Timeline Expectations 💡
Electrical panel upgrades are an investment in your property, but they don’t have to be a mystery. Here’s what affects the price and schedule:
- Panel Size: Replacing a small residential panel is less complex than upgrading a large commercial system.
- Wiring Needs: If wiring, circuits, or service upgrades are needed, this adds time and cost.
- Permits and Inspections: These are required by law and ensure everything meets current codes, like those specified by the National Fire Protection Association (NFPA).
- Downtime: Most residential upgrades are completed in a day. Commercial projects or complicated rewiring may take longer.
On average, expect a basic residential upgrade to take 6–8 hours. Larger or more complex jobs can stretch over 1–2 days.
Safety Benefits of Modern Panels
Upgrading your panel is like swapping out an old, unreliable lock for a state-of-the-art security system. Here’s what you gain:
- Reduced Fire Risk: Modern panels are designed with updated safety features that help prevent electrical fires.
- Code Compliance: Stay up-to-date with the latest safety standards, including GFCI and AFCI protection where required.
- More Power, More Flexibility: Safely add appliances, EV chargers, or home automation without fear of overload.
- Insurance Peace of Mind: Many insurers require up-to-date electrical systems for coverage.
Real-World Risks of Old Panels
Some panels, like the infamous Federal Pacific Electric (FPE) or Zinsco brands, are known for design flaws that increase fire risk. If your property has one of these, replacement isn’t just recommended—it’s urgent.

Frequently Asked Questions
How do I know if my panel is safe?
If you’re unsure, schedule a professional safety inspection—especially if you notice any warning signs like frequent tripping or a hot panel.
Can I upgrade just some breakers, or do I need a whole new panel?
If your panel is old or has known safety issues, replacing only breakers won’t fix the underlying problems. A full upgrade is often the safest choice.
Does my insurance require a panel upgrade?
Many insurance companies require up-to-date electrical systems for new or renewed policies. An upgraded panel may even help with lower premiums.
Is there a good time of year for upgrades?
Panel upgrades can be done year-round, but planning for a time when you can handle a short power outage is smart.
